Abstract
Produced the utility model discloses a kind of glycine betaine salicylate of electromechanical integration technology area and use evaporative filtration device, including evaporating column tank, the intracavity bottom of the evaporating column tank is provided with heater, evaporating dish is provided with the top of the heater, the left side wall of the evaporating column tank is provided with feed pipe, and the bottom of feed pipe is arranged on the inner chamber of evaporating dish, the outer wall of the feed pipe is provided with flow valve, the mutual cooperation that the utility model passes through heating wire in heater and temperature sensor, facilitate control of the operating personnel to evaporating temperature, make the product quality of production higher, pass through the mutual cooperation of oxidation catalyst filter device and filter, the amount of pollutant in reduction discharge gas, pass through the mutual cooperation of condenser and return duct, enable the glycine betaine salicylate contained in boil-off gas to be condensed to be back in evaporating dish again, reduce the loss of product, reduce production cost.

Operation principle:The utility model is heated by the heating wire 21 in heater 2 to evaporating dish 3, by adding
Temperature sensor 22 in thermal 2 monitors the heating-up temperature of heating wire 21, facilitates operator to the tune of the heating-up temperature of evaporating dish 3
Section, is heated by heater 2 to evaporating dish 3, makes the raw material entered by feed pipe 4 in evaporating dish 3 by evaporative crystallization, simultaneously
Air after air purifier 8 is purified by blower fan 7 is entered in the evaporating dish 3 containing raw material liq by blast pipe 6, is passed through
The entrance of air enables the raw material liq in evaporating dish 3 to roll, and makes the evaporative crystallization of raw material liq more uniform, while plus
The evaporation of extract solution in fast liquid charging stock, the gas of evaporation first passes through difference of the condenser 9 according to set point, makes boil-off gas
In the gas condensation of glycine betaine salicylate that contains, the phase interworking that the drop after condensation passes through draining plate 10 and return duct 11
Close, being again introduced into evaporating dish 3 for concentration is evaporated again, the gas after being filtered by condenser 9 passes through oxidation catalyst filter device again
12 and uviol lamp 13 mutual cooperation carry out oxidation catalyst filter, reduce discharge air in harmful substance amount, eventually passed
Filter device 15 is discharged after filtering by blast pipe 14.
